Volleyball Canada – Come and watch Canada’s journey to the World Championships begin in Langley!!  

The 2017 Senior Women’s Continental Championship (Group B) / World Championship Qualification Final will be held at the Langley Events Centre during the final weekend of September.
 
“We are very pleased to host this NORCECA (North, Central America and Caribbean Volleyball Confederation) event in Langley,” said Alan Ahac, Volleyball Canada’s Director of International Events. “Langley has a very vibrant volleyball community and we’re excited to host another international tournament in this area with our partners at Volleyball BC, Trinity Western University and Langley Events Centre.”
 
The top two finishing teams at this event will earn a berth in the World Championships, to be held in Japan in 2018. The qualification process started in May 2016 and lasts until 2018. The Worlds in Japan will include five teams from Asia (including hosts), two from Africa, eight from Europe, two from South America and seven (including defending champions USA) from the North, Central America and Caribbean. The 24 participating teams will compete against each other in 102 matches that will take place over 15 days.

Canada’s men’s team will compete in a similar event in Colorado Springs, USA, at the same time in order to qualify for the Men’s World Championships.
 
Thursday September 28:
 
5:30pm  Cuba vs Nicaragua
8:00pm  Canada vs St Lucia
 
Friday September 29:
 
5:30pm  Cuba vs St Lucia
8:00pm  Canada v Nicaragua
 
Saturday September 30:
 
5:30pm  St Lucia vs Nicaragua
8:00pm  Canada vs Cuba
